OWSC games are a mix between insanely fun and overly tedious. On one hand you have some really cool concepts in; building, crafting, and fighting. On the other hand you have chopping trees, grass, or other items just to build a home that is safe can be dreadful, boring, and loathsome. Especially when you're miles from your base and you die.

Then you have Abiotic Factor. A game which focuses on crafting and exploration more than building a base with a roof over your head. Going from level to level, grinding out stats and just enjoying the world, creatures, and high stakes gameplay is absolutely wonderful without having to worry if your base is perfect. Or if you're going to lose everything once you die.

Abiotic Factor takes all the things I hate and removes them in favor of fun and adds another layer by being inside instead of in the woods, desert, or plains. Hopefully others take notice and start getting more creative.

Steam Deck user;

Game is fun, honestly it's worth the play like all the positive reviews have stated.

It reminds me of a mix between a deck builder and 10,000,000. Progression is unique and the town building is charming.

BUT; I cannot recommend playing on the steam deck. The resolution is 1280x720 for the standard load in. There is NO 1280 x 800. So some of the info you need is actually OFF the screen.
If you fiddle with the settings, you absolutely have to enter into Borderless Window (Which stretches the screen).

Secondly, I would LOVE to use my touch pad a bit more on this, but for some reason it locks out and you're having to move the analog sticks to get the touch pads to work. It would be great to just use the touch pad to just click and rearrange the backpack with.

While I'll personally continue to play (it's relaxing to me, what can I say). I cannot recommend another steam deck user to jump in expecting a crisp and clean experience until the developers review these issues.
